The U.S. pushes to introduce Defund China's Allies Act, banning financial aid to Honduras and other 21 countries

Faced with the CCP’s long-term suppression of Taiwan and poaching 9 countries with diplomatic relations in the past 7 years, U.S. Representative Ogles proposed a bill calling for a ban on providing financial aid to these countries that have abandoned Taiwan and defected to the CCP. Honduras tops the list of 21 countries included in the bill. This bill points out that the CCP’s diplomatic suppression of Taiwan is a threat to the national security of the United States. If the United States does not take actual actions, it will increase the risk of armed conflict in the Taiwan Strait.

U.S. Republican Congressman Andy Ogles and five members of the same party jointly proposed the "Defund China's Allies Act", which prohibits the United States from providing diplomatic aid to countries that have severed diplomatic relations with Taiwan and turned to the CCP. Honduras is listed first in the sanctions list while 20 other countries including Nicaragua and Dominican Republic are included in the sanctions.

News (2)

Defund China's Allies Act condemns the countries for surrendering to the CCP, the U.S. should fully establish diplomatic relations with Taiwan

In the 2021 fiscal year, the United States has assisted these 21 countries with nearly 800 million US dollars. In addition to stopping aid, this bill condemns 21 countries for surrendering to the CCP, which has committed genocide. It expressly states that the diplomatic diversion of these countries is a threat to the national security of the United States. If the United States does not stop it, it will further increase the tension in the Taiwan Strait. Therefore, within 30 days of the passage of the bill, the United States should fully establish diplomatic relations with Taiwan.

The domestic covid epidemic situation has slowed down, and many policies have been gradually relaxed. Starting 17 April 2023, even public transportation vehicles will no longer be mandatory for people to wear masks, and they will only be "recommended" to wear. In order to avoid confusion among the public, Wang Bisheng, the commander of the command center, also said that some people did not understand the new rules. 

In short, starting from 17 April 2023, the place where it is required to wear is the "medical long-term care institution", and others are self-wearing . "TVBS News Network" also sorts out the frequently asked questions about the new system of masks for you, the lazy bag and the new system.

Q: When will the new system of masks go on the road? What does public transportation include?
The command center announced that starting from 417 April 2023, the wearing of masks in public transportation will be relaxed. Including MRT, Taiwan Railway, high-speed rail, bus, passenger transport, etc., the public can decide whether to wear a mask or not.

 
Q: Where else is it mandatory to wear a mask?
(1) Medical care institutions: medical care, medical affairs, welfare for the elderly, long-term care services, honorary national homes, children and juvenile services, and welfare institutions for the physically and mentally disabled.

(2) Ambulance.

Exceptions for not wearing a mask in the above-mentioned designated places: eating, drinking, taking pictures, examinations, treatments or activities where masks are not suitable or cannot be worn.

Q: In what situations is it recommended to wear a mask?
(1) Fever or respiratory symptoms.

(2) When the elderly or immunocompromised go out.

(3) Places where crowds gather and proper distance cannot be maintained or ventilation is poor.

(4) When in close contact with the elderly or immunocompromised (especially those who have not been fully vaccinated).

(5) When taking public transportation and specific vehicles (rehabilitation buses, school buses, special vehicles for kindergartens, and campus shuttle buses).
 
Q: Can I take off my mask on the school bus?
The command center stated that school buses, kindergarten buses, and campus shuttle buses will be changed from the requirement to wear masks to "recommended wearing masks" in accordance with public transportation, and will be implemented on 17 April 2023.
 
Q: After the lifting of the ban, will there be any penalty for not wearing a mask in a place where it is mandatory to wear a mask?
If people deliberately and maliciously violate the regulations in medical care institutions and ambulances without wearing masks and do not listen to persuasion, they will be fined NT$3,000 to NT$15,000 in accordance with Article 70 of the "Law on the Prevention and Control of Infectious Diseases", and failure to improve will be punished on a case-by-case basis.

The leaked documents from the Pentagon of the United States revealed more inside stories about the CCP’s spy balloons. The top leaders of the CCP are suspected of being at odds. Insiders accused the CCP’s Ministry of Foreign Affairs of handling the spy balloon’s intrusion into the U.S. airspace, triggering the Sino-U.S. crisis.

The Washington Post reported on 14 April 2023 that leaked documents from the Pentagon revealed that some government departments in the CCP were caught off guard by the shooting down of a CCP spy balloon that invaded U.S. airspace in February, leading to disagreements among high-level officials.

The document evaluates that this incident may only be known to a small number of people within the CCP military, and the military lacks "high-level strong" supervision sensation of the spy balloon program.

The dozens of classified documents leaked by the Pentagon were posted on the social platform Discord by Jack Teixeira, a member of the Massachusetts Air National Guard. He was arrested on 13 April and charged on 15 April 2023 with "unauthorized retention and transmission of national defense information, and unauthorized deletion and retention of classified documents."

The documents, produced by the U.S. National Geospatial-Intelligence Agency (NGA), are dated 15 February 2023, showing they were produced 10 days after the U.S. military shot down the Chinese spy balloon.

The document shows that the US intelligence agency referred to the downed CCP spy balloon as "Killeen-23" (Killeen-23). Detailed photos of the balloon are attached to the document, presumably taken by the US U-2 reconnaissance plane.

The balloon has the logo of Eagles Men Aviation Science and Technology Group Co., Ltd. and the words "Static Stratospheric Constellation System" in Chinese. After the United States shot down the Chinese spy balloon, it sanctioned 6 Chinese companies, and the company is also on the sanctions list.

In addition to the downed balloon, U.S. officials are aware of at least four other Chinese spy balloons, leaked documents show. One of the balloons flew over a U.S. aircraft carrier strike group on a mission in the Pacific Ocean, while the other crashed in the South China Sea.

The document made a detailed assessment of "Killeen-23" and the other two balloons "Bulger 21" and "Acado 21". The "Bulger 21" balloon has a sophisticated monitoring device and will fly around the earth from December 2021 to May 2022; the "Arcador 21" also has a similar device and a gimbal sensor lined with a metal film.

The document states that the solar panels carried by Killeen-23 can generate up to 10,000 watts of electricity to power a synthetic aperture radar that takes images at night and through clouds.

This kind of radar is different from traditional optical sensors. It uses microwave pulses sent to the earth to generate images. It can return images at night and can pass through clouds, smog, topsoil, ice and snow, and can even penetrate thin materials such as tarpaulins to show the object below.

There is also a 1.2-meter disc-shaped device on "Killeen-23", several unknown sensors and an item that may be an antenna stand. Since no image of the bottom of the balloon payload was collected, it was impossible to analyze whether there was an optical sensor.

The Washington Post reported that the downed Killeen-23 carried "a large number of sensors and antennas" around the world, but the U.S. government has yet to confirm this more than a week after shooting down the balloon.

At the end of January this year, a CCP spy balloon invaded the U.S. airspace, causing an uproar, and U.S. Secretary of State Blinken canceled his plan to visit China. The U.S. military dispatched warplanes on 4 February 2023 to shoot down the spy balloon over the waters of South Carolina, and salvaged the balloon wreckage for investigation and research.

China accuses the US of shooting down the balloon as an exaggeration, and has repeatedly denied that the balloon has the function of gathering intelligence. But the U.S. countered, pointing out that the balloon was controlled by the CCP military, and the balloon incident further deteriorated Sino-U.S. relations.

The Financial Times reported on 15 April 2023 that Beijing has told Washington that it is not planning to reschedule Blinken's visit to China, and that it is unclear how the Biden administration will handle the FBI's investigation into the Chinese spy balloon, according to four people familiar with the negotiations.

On 11 April 2023, Blinken held a joint press conference with U.S. Secretary of Defense Austin, as well as visiting Philippine Foreign Minister Manalo and Defense Secretary Galvez. Blinken said that the United States does not seek to contain the CCP and will continue to look for ways to strengthen bilateral communication channels. He hopes to continue to visit mainland China when conditions are ripe.

In February of this year, Blinken's planned visit to China was canceled because of the CCP spy balloon incident.

In late January, a giant Chinese spy balloon entered U.S. airspace in Alaska, then passed through Canada and down into the U.S. state of Montana, where it hovered for several days, where Malmstrom Air Force Base is located. The U.S. believes the Chinese spy balloon was trying to spy on sensitive U.S. military locations.

On 4 February, the U.S. military shot down the CCP spy balloon on the east coast. The balloon incident exacerbated the deterioration of U.S.-China relations. Blinken canceled plans to visit China, saying the timing was inappropriate.

China has repeatedly claimed that the balloon was for civilian use and strayed into U.S. airspace due to force majeure, saying the U.S. overreacted by shooting it down.

The U.S. side pointed out that the downed Chinese spy balloon has the ability to collect electronic signals and can collect intelligence from several sensitive U.S. military locations.

On 3 April 2023, the National Broadcasting Corporation (NBC) quoted two current senior U.S. officials and a former senior government official as saying that the CCP can control spy balloons to fly over certain areas repeatedly, sometimes in a figure-eight shape. Pass through and transmit the collected intelligence back to Beijing in real time.

"Intelligence gathered by China is primarily based on electronic signals rather than imagery, which can be obtained from weapons systems or communications by base personnel," the officials said, if it weren't for the U.S. government's efforts to prevent Chinese spy balloons from sending the collected intelligence back , the CCP may collect more sensitive information on US military bases.

After the U.S. military finished salvaging the wreckage of the Chinese spy balloon, the FBI conducted an investigation, but the investigation report has not yet been released.

Recently, multiple confidential documents from the Pentagon of the United States have been leaked, revealing more inside information about the CCP’s spy balloons.

The "Washington Post" reported on April 15 that leaked National Geospatial-Intelligence Agency documents pointed out that, in addition to the balloon shot down in February, the United States has detected and named several Chinese spy balloons in previous years.

Authorities assess that these balloons are equipped with sophisticated surveillance equipment such as radars and sensors that can monitor and reconnaissance at night and through clouds.

Another confidential document shows that some people in the CCP government were caught off guard by the incident of the CCP spy balloon flying over the United States at the end of January. Some people in the government accused the Ministry of Foreign Affairs of handling it poorly, which triggered a diplomatic crisis between CCP China and the United States.

The Wuhan pneumonia (covid, COVID-19) epidemic has seriously disrupted the pace of the world in the past 3 years, causing hundreds of millions of people to be diagnosed and millions of people to die. There are constant voices of blame, but CCP China, which can be regarded as the source of the epidemic, continues to shrug it off. The U.S. House of Representatives is expected to hold a hearing on the origin of the epidemic on 18 April 2023 but the CCP sent a letter of protest. The subcommittee in charge of the hearing of the U.S. House of Representatives released the content of the Chinese protest letter on 15 April 2023, exposing the unreasonableness of the CCP’s attempt to interfere in the traceability work act.

According to "Fox News", in order to carry out relevant legislation such as tracing the source of the Wuhan pneumonia epidemic, the "House Select Subcommittee on the Coronavirus Pandemic" (House Select Subcommittee on the Coronavirus Pandemic) of the US House of Representatives is expected to be chaired by Rep. Brad Wenstrup chaired the hearing. After the news came to light, the committee received a letter of protest from the CCP embassy in the United States last Friday (14 April).

In the face of the CCP’s protest, the committee not only ignored the pressure, but also directly released the content of the protest letter from the Chinese embassy through the official Twitter yesterday (15th), accusing the Chinese embassy of trying to interfere in the US investigation into the origin of the epidemic, and asking the relevant people to “keep "silence.

From the content of the letter released by the committee, it can be seen that the letter was sent at 2:15 am on the 14th, and the letter read: "I am reaching out to express our grave concern regarding the COVID-19 Origins hearing to be chaired by Congressman Wenstrup next Tuesday. According to the announcement, this hearing is to investigate "China's complicity in the COVID-19" crisis and hold China accountable. We firmly oppose it." The Committee responded, All Chinese actions to stop the covid origins investigations are in vain, "We will continue to pursue the facts and convey the truth to the Americans."

Li Xiang puts pressure on members of Congress seeking information about the origin of the covid virus


According to a Fox News report, this is not the first time that the CCP embassy in the United States has tried to put pressure on members of Congress seeking information about the origin of the covid virus. Li Xiang also sent an email to the chief of staff of Federal Senator Josh Hawley in March 2023, saying that Hawley's proposal to declassify information related to the origin of covid is an act of "political manipulation".

A member of the committee commented, "What is China trying to hide? The Chinese embassy's attempt to silence the committee on the Covid-19 investigation is absurd and will not work. It is wrong not to hold China accountable for its role in the crisis. It is an important part of our nation's preparations for future national security threats and pandemics."

In the hearing of the House of Representatives on 18 April, John Ratcliffe, the former Director of National Intelligence (DNI), and David Feith, the former Deputy Assistant Secretary for East Asian and Pacific Affairs of the United States, will attend the hearing and testify.

On 15 April 2023, the Taiwan Public Opinion Foundation announced the latest "Taiwanese's latest political party support tendency" poll. Although the Democratic Progressive Party (DPP) continued to rank first with 28.6% support, the KMT rose by 8% in April and came to 25.9%. In this regard, the Taiwan Public Opinion Foundation also analyzed that the key to the "bottom rebound" of the blue camp is mainly inspired by three factors.

The Facebook fan of the Taiwan Public Opinion Foundation released the latest poll on "Taiwanese's latest political party support tendency" on the 15th. The support rates were 28.6%, 25.9%, and 15%, respectively. Among them, the support of the DPP and the People's Party (PP) hardly changed, but the KMT rose by 8% in one breath.

According to the analysis of the Taiwan Public Opinion Foundation, in the five months since the 9-in-1 general election in 2022, the support of the KMT has fluctuated "three ups and two downs", and both the decline and the increase have a trend of "big ups and downs", especially this month. The "V-shaped bottom rebound" appeared again, and the reason is worthy of scrutiny.

The Taiwan Public Opinion Foundation believes that, from the perspective of the overall situation, the "V-shaped rebound" of the KMT this time is mainly due to "Ma Ying-jeou's trip to the mainland to worship ancestors", "Founder of Hon Hai Group Terry Gou officially announced his bid for the 2024 presidential nomination", "New Taipei Mayor Hou You-yih's attitude is gradually becoming more positive and clear" three factors.
